Otsiikin Thermopsis rhombifolia information
Traditional knowledge
Otsiikin "Buffalo bean" is one of the earliest flowers to bloom in spring, and an indication that winter has come to an end. When the yellow flowers bloom it is time to begin preparations for the year's Okan (Sundance).
Description
Upright perennial (20–60 cm) with grey-green leaves divided into three broad leaflets. Produces clusters of bright yellow pea-like flowers followed by slender seed pods.
